Grade Levels

Our STEM program welcomes students from grades 1-6, offering a unique learning experience. 

We group students into three collaborative cohorts: 

  • Grades 1-2,
  • Grades 3-4, 
  • Grades 5-6. 

This approach allows for peer-to-peer learning, with younger students gaining inspiration from their older peers, while older students deepen their understanding by mentoring others.
